Meridian works primarily with consumer-facing businesses. Over the years, that experience has included everything from beauty and personal care to food, retail, commerce, luxury, and consumer services. Rather than specializing in a single category, Meridian brings perspective from across industries where understanding people and changing markets is central to business success.

Meridian is based in the New York City metropolitan area and works with organizations locally, nationally, and internationally. Engagements can take place virtually, in person, or through a combination of both, depending on the needs of the project.
